– Definition of PDR (Paintless Dent Repair)
Paintless Dent Repair (PDR) is a specialized car body repair technique that has gained significant popularity among auto body shops and dealerships. This innovative approach to vehicle body repair focuses on removing dents, dings, and minor damage from a car’s exterior without the need for traditional painting or extensive panel replacement. PDR for car dealerships offers several advantages, including reduced downtime for customers, cost-effectiveness, and minimal impact on the overall aesthetics of the vehicle.
By utilizing advanced tools and trained technicians, PDR expertly manipulates a car’s metal to realign it to its original factory finish. This non-invasive method preserves the factory paint job, ensuring that cars leave the dealership looking as good as new. With PDR, dealerships can provide quick and efficient services for minor scratches, dents, or even larger damage, all while maintaining a high standard of customer satisfaction and retaining their vehicle’s value.
– Benefits for dealerships: cost savings, increased efficiency, customer satisfaction
Implementing PDR for car dealerships offers a multitude of advantages that can significantly transform operations and boost profitability. One of the most notable benefits is cost savings; by utilizing paintless dent repair techniques, dealerships can reduce their reliance on traditional auto bodywork and collision repair centers, which often involve extensive paintwork and labor-intensive processes. This results in lower material and overhead costs, allowing for better financial management.
Furthermore, PDR enhances operational efficiency. The non-invasive nature of this technique means less time spent on repairs, faster turnaround times, and improved workflow management. Satisfied customers are also a direct outcome, as PDR offers a quicker, cleaner, and more discreet solution compared to conventional repair methods. This can lead to increased customer loyalty and positive word-of-mouth, contributing to the dealership’s overall success in a competitive market.
